OSCE Final Report on 2013Parliamentary Elections in Monaco, p. 13, http://www.osce.org/odihr/elections/101353
“Each voter or electoralcontestant has the right to submit a complaint. All grievances can be filed withthe court of first instance. Decisions of this court could be appealed to thecourt of appeals and then referred to the court of revision, as a lastinstance.”
The time limit toissue a verdict at the first instance is not specified. An appeal to theverdict of the first instance should be submitted within 10 days. The secondinstance has a month (30 days) to issue a verdict. However, if the case isconsidered urgent, the court must issue a verdict within 10 days. The decisionof the second instance can be appealed to the court of revision, but notimelines are specified for this.
